Creating Your Digital Invoice: The Essential Steps
To effectively learn how to make an invoice through email, you need to understand the core components and the process itself. It’s not just about attaching a document; it’s about presenting information clearly and professionally.
Having a well-crafted invoice is vital for ensuring you get paid promptly and that your clients understand exactly what they owe you.
Here's a breakdown of what you'll need to include and do:
-
Your Business Information: This includes your business name, address, and contact details (phone number, email address).
-
Client's Information: The name and address of the person or company you are invoicing.
-
Invoice Number: A unique identifier for each invoice is important for tracking.
-
Date: The date the invoice is issued.
-
Due Date: The date by which payment is expected.
-
Description of Services/Products: A clear and detailed list of what you provided.
-
Quantities and Unit Prices: If applicable, list the number of items or hours and their individual cost.
-
Total Amount Due: The final sum that needs to be paid.
-
Payment Terms: Any specific conditions regarding payment (e.g., Net 30, payment methods accepted).
Once you have all the necessary information, you can create the invoice itself. Many businesses use accounting software or simple invoice templates. You can find plenty of free templates online that you can download and customize. Alternatively, you can create one using a word processor or spreadsheet program. The key is to make it easy to read and understand. After filling out the template or creating your document, save it as a PDF. This ensures that the formatting remains consistent across different devices and email clients, preventing any messy layout issues.
Finally, when you're ready to send, compose a new email. Use a clear and concise subject line, such as "Invoice [Invoice Number] from [Your Business Name]". In the email body, briefly introduce the invoice, mention the total amount due, and reiterate the payment due date. Attach the PDF invoice and send it to your client.
